General annotation (Comments)
| Function | Plays a role in cell wall integrity. Affects the cell wall polymer composition in the growing region of the cell. Ref.1 |
| Subcellular location | Cell membrane; Single-pass type III membrane protein; Cytoplasmic side. Bud membrane; Single-pass type III membrane protein; Cytoplasmic side. Note: Localizes on the inner surface of the plasma membrane at the bud and in the daughter cell. Localizes at an incipient bud site in the cells with emerging buds, a bud tip in small- or medium-budded cells, and a cell periphery in large-budded cells. Ref.1 Ref.5 |
| Sequence similarities | Belongs to the SKG1 family. |
| Sequence caution | The sequence CAA82180.1 differs from that shown. Reason: Frameshift at position 234. |
